- afsar malikMar 24, 2022 · 3 years agoSure! Here's a step-by-step guide to sending cryptocurrency to someone else: 1. Choose a wallet: First, you need to have a cryptocurrency wallet. There are different types of wallets available, such as hardware wallets, software wallets, and online wallets. Choose a wallet that suits your needs and install it on your device. 2. Get the recipient's wallet address: Ask the person you want to send cryptocurrency to for their wallet address. It is a long string of alphanumeric characters unique to their wallet. 3. Open your wallet: Open your cryptocurrency wallet and navigate to the 'Send' or 'Transfer' section. 4. Enter the recipient's wallet address: In the 'Send' section, enter the recipient's wallet address that you obtained in the previous step. 5. Specify the amount: Enter the amount of cryptocurrency you want to send to the recipient. Make sure to double-check the amount to avoid any mistakes. 6. Confirm the transaction: Review the transaction details, including the recipient's wallet address and the amount, and confirm the transaction. 7. Pay the transaction fee: Depending on the cryptocurrency and the network congestion, you may need to pay a transaction fee. This fee is required to process and validate the transaction. 8. Wait for confirmation: After confirming the transaction, you need to wait for the network to validate and confirm the transaction. This process may take a few minutes to several hours, depending on the cryptocurrency and network. 9. Transaction completed: Once the transaction is confirmed, the cryptocurrency will be sent to the recipient's wallet. You can verify the transaction by checking the transaction history in your wallet or using a blockchain explorer. That's it! You have successfully sent cryptocurrency to someone else. Remember to always double-check the recipient's wallet address to avoid sending funds to the wrong address.
